According to PANews, Mind Network has announced a strategic partnership with BytePlus, a cloud computing platform under ByteDance. The collaboration aims to advance secure AI inference and a trusted agent ecosystem, promoting the implementation of reliable AI.
BytePlus will provide Mind Network access to its large language model, DeepSeek, through standardized APIs. Mind Network will employ fully homomorphic encryption (FHE) to secure the entire inference process, ensuring safety from input to model output. The computation and verification processes will be executed using BytePlus's Function Compute infrastructure, balancing high performance with security.
Additionally, Mind Network will integrate its Model Context Protocol (MCP) component into BytePlus and ByteDance's agent platform, Coze. This integration will offer agents default encryption, on-chain verification, and cross-platform collaboration capabilities, supporting secure operations within ecosystems like Lark. Mind Network will become the first infrastructure provider to implement FHE services on Lark.
